    Horsepower Specs: Decoding the Powerhouse

    Alright, let's talk numbers! The 2020 Tesla Model S Dual Motor delivered impressive horsepower figures that varied slightly depending on the specific trim level. Generally, you could expect around 660 to 778 horsepower combined from the front and rear motors. But hold on, the numbers can be a little nuanced. Tesla, in its quest for innovation, often tweaked the power output with over-the-air software updates, meaning the actual horsepower available could change over time. The precise horsepower also depended on whether you had the Long Range or Performance trim. The Performance trim, as you might guess, typically boasted the higher end of that horsepower range, offering exhilarating acceleration. This power is achieved because the dual-motor system meant that one electric motor was dedicated to the front wheels and another to the rear wheels. This not only provided incredible horsepower, but it also enhanced the car's traction and handling. Let's not forget the immediate torque delivery that electric motors are famous for! This instant torque catapults the Model S from 0 to 60 mph in a breathtakingly short amount of time. We'll explore that more later.     Acceleration: From 0 to 60 in a Blink

    Now, let's talk about the fun stuff – acceleration! The 2020 Tesla Model S Dual Motor was renowned for its astonishing 0 to 60 mph times. The Performance trim could achieve this feat in as little as 2.4 seconds in its quickest iterations. That's faster than many supercars and certainly faster than most other sedans on the market at the time. The Long Range model wasn't a slouch either, generally clocking in at around 3.7 seconds. This level of acceleration is made possible by the instant torque delivery of the electric motors. There's no lag, no waiting for the engine to spool up; the power is there immediately, pushing you back into your seat the moment you hit the accelerator. The all-wheel-drive system also plays a crucial role in these blistering acceleration times. It ensures that the power is efficiently transferred to the road, minimizing wheel spin and maximizing grip. This combination of powerful electric motors and a sophisticated all-wheel-drive system made the 2020 Tesla Model S Dual Motor one of the quickest accelerating production cars available.     Factors Influencing Acceleration

    Several factors influence the 0 to 60 mph acceleration times of the 2020 Tesla Model S Dual Motor. These include the trim level (Performance vs. Long Range), the battery's state of charge, the temperature, and the road surface conditions. The Performance trim has a more powerful motor and better acceleration times. The battery's state of charge is also important because it provides the electric motors with the power they need to generate maximum acceleration. In colder temperatures, the battery's performance may be reduced, which will slightly affect acceleration. Road conditions also have an impact; a dry road will provide more grip than a wet one, resulting in quicker acceleration. Tesla constantly updated its software, and these updates sometimes impacted the acceleration performance. These updates can sometimes provide additional performance improvements.     Technology Behind the Power

    The 2020 Tesla Model S Dual Motor isn't just about horsepower; it's about the technology that makes that power so accessible and efficient. The dual-motor system is the heart of its performance, with an electric motor at the front and another at the rear. These motors work in harmony to deliver all-wheel drive, providing optimal traction and control. The battery pack is another critical component. It provides the energy that powers the electric motors. Tesla uses advanced battery technology to ensure high energy density, long-range capabilities, and rapid charging speeds. The car's software plays a massive role in managing the power delivery and optimizing performance. The software controls the acceleration, regenerative braking, and other features that enhance the driving experience. Tesla's over-the-air software updates are another standout feature. They allow Tesla to improve the car's performance and add new features without the owner having to take the car to a service center. The regenerative braking system captures energy during deceleration and feeds it back into the battery. This helps increase the car's efficiency and range.     Comparing to the Competition

    When the 2020 Tesla Model S Dual Motor was released, it didn't just compete against other electric vehicles; it went toe-to-toe with high-performance gas-powered cars. Cars like the Porsche Panamera Turbo and the BMW M5 were its main rivals. The Model S offered similar or superior acceleration and performance while providing the benefits of electric vehicle ownership (zero emissions and lower running costs). The instant torque of the electric motors gave the Model S an edge in off-the-line acceleration. The Model S has a sleek design. The interior is modern and minimalist. These features give the Model S an advantage over its rivals. In terms of range, the Long Range version of the Model S could travel further on a single charge than many of its competitors. Tesla's Supercharger network provided convenient and fast charging options, which helped mitigate any range anxiety. The Model S also had an advantage in terms of technology. Its Autopilot and over-the-air software updates set it apart from its rivals. However, the Model S faced competition from other electric vehicles like the Porsche Taycan. The Taycan delivered amazing performance and a luxurious driving experience. The Model S continued to stand out due to its long range and advanced technology.
